关于HTTPS通信的深入探讨与解析
一、引言
随着互联网技术的飞速发展,网络安全问题日益受到关注。
HTTP协议作为互联网中最常用的通信协议之一,其安全性不断得到强化。
HTTPS就是在HTTP基础上通过SSL/TLS协议提供加密通信的安全版本。
本文将深入探讨HTTPS通信的原理、优势及与HTTP协议相关的误区。
二、HTTP与HTTPS概述
HTTP(Hypertext Transfer Protocol)是一种应用层协议,用于在Internet上进行信息的传输。
HTTPS则是在HTTP基础上添加了SSL/TLS协议,通过加密技术对传输数据进行加密,确保数据传输的安全性。
三、HTTPS通信原理
HTTPS通信基于SSL/TLS协议,其核心过程包括密钥交换、证书验证和数据传输三个阶段。
1. 密钥交换:客户端与服务器通过协商,生成一对密钥对,用于数据的加密和解密。
2. 证书验证:服务器向客户端提供数字证书,证明其身份。客户端验证数字证书的真实性后,确认与服务器进行安全通信。
3. 数据传输:客户端和服务器使用协商好的密钥对进行数据加密和解密,实现安全通信。
四、HTTPS通信的优势
1. 数据加密:HTTPS采用SSL/TLS协议对数据进行加密,确保数据传输过程中的安全性。
2. 防止数据篡改:由于数据在传输过程中被加密,因此可以有效防止中间人攻击和数据篡改。
3. 身份验证:通过数字证书验证服务器身份,确保与合法服务器进行通信。
4. 保护隐私:HTTPS可以保护用户的隐私信息,如登录账号、密码等,避免被第三方窃取。
五、关于HTTP协议的错误说法解析
关于HTTP协议的说法有很多误区,以下是常见的错误说法及其解析:
1. HTTP协议不安全:这一说法过于笼统。HTTP协议本身并不提供数据加解密功能,但在实际应用中,通过结合SSL/TLS协议,可以实现对数据的加密传输,提高通信安全性。因此,HTTP协议的安全性取决于其应用场景和使用方式。
2. HTTP协议不支持持久连接:这一说法已经过时。HTTP/1.1协议引入了持久连接(persistent connection)的概念,支持在同一TCP连接上发送多个请求和接收多个响应,提高了网络应用的性能。
3. HTTP协议只支持文本传输:HTTP协议不仅可以传输文本数据,还可以传输二进制数据。在实际应用中,可以通过设置Content-Type头部字段来指定数据的类型。
4. HTTP协议无法验证服务器身份:这一说法不准确。通过数字证书和公钥基础设施(PKI),HTTP协议可以实现服务器身份验证,确保客户端与合法服务器进行通信。
六、HTTPS的应用场景
HTTPS广泛应用于互联网各个领域,如网银、电商、社交媒体、搜索引擎等。
在这些场景中,用户需要传输敏感信息,如账号密码、交易数据、个人隐私等。
通过HTTPS通信,可以确保数据的安全性,保护用户的合法权益。
七、结论
HTTPS通信在互联网安全中扮演着重要角色,通过对数据的加密、防止数据篡改、身份验证和保护隐私等功能,提高了网络通信的安全性。
同时,关于HTTP协议的误区也需要我们了解并澄清,以便更好地理解和应用HTTP和HTTPS协议。
随着网络技术的不断发展,HTTPS将在更多领域得到广泛应用,为互联网安全保驾护航。
跪求答案Internet域名中的域类型“COM”代表单位的性质是( )
17.Internet域名中的域类型“COM”代表单位的性质是(d )A)通信机构 B)网络机构 C)组织机构 D)商业机构18.Internet域名中的域类型“ORG”代表单位的性质是( c)A)通信机构 B)网络机构 C)组织机构 D)商业机构19.Internet域名中的域类型“NET”代表单位的性质是( b)A)通信机构 B)网络机构 C)组织机构 D)商业机构20.以下关于进入Web站点的说法正确的是(d )A)只能输入域名 B)只能输入IP地址C)需同时输入IP地址和域名 D)可以通过输入IP地址或者域名21.下面不属于客户端程序的是( d)A)电子邮件阅读程序 B)文件传送程序C) Web浏览器 D) DNS22.不是推动WWW发展的三大主要动力为(C )A) HTML B) Web浏览器C) Java语言 D)多媒体技术23.下面不是浏览器的有(c )A)腾讯浏览器 B) Web服务器C)Netscape D) Internet Explorer24.下列关于搜索引擎的说法中不正确的是( b)A)可以提供信息查询服务B)搜索引擎是一些软件应用程序C)其主要方法有分类查询和关键字查询两种D)用来收集Web站点的URL地址并建立分类目标的数据库25.BBS是指(d )A)远程登录协议B)文件传输协议,可实现文件上载和下载C)在客户机和服务器之间互相传输文件的一种服务D)电子公告牌系统,用户可以发布信息或提出看法的一块电子公共臼板26.计算机网络最突出的优点是( d)A)精度高 B)内存容量大 C)运算速度快 D)共享资源27.信息高速公路上信息的传送基本形式是(d )A)二进制数据 B)系统软件 C)应用软件 D)多媒体信息28.中国教育科研计算机网是(b )A)NCFC B)CERNET C)IDSN D) Internet29. Outlook Express是一个___c___处理程序。 (5)A.文字B.表格 C.电子邮件 D.幻灯片30.使用浏览器上网时,__b__ 不可能影响系统和个人信息安全。 A. 浏览包含有病毒的网站 B.改变浏览器显示网页文字的字体大小 C.在网站上输入银行帐号、口令等敏感信息 D.下载和安装互联网上的软件或者程序31.邮件服务器使用POP3 的主要目的是__c__ 。 A. 创建邮件 B. 管理邮件C.收发邮件 D. 删除邮件 中域名与IP地址之间的翻译是由__a__ 来完成的。 A. 域名服务器B. 代理服务器 C.FTP 服务器D.Web 服务器服务使用的协议为___b_ 。 A. HTML B. HTTPC. SMTP D. FTP34.在Outlook 中可以借助___a_ 的方式传送一个文件。 A.FTPB.导出C. 导入 D. 附件 Explorer是目前流行的浏览器软件,它的主要功能之一是浏览_4_。 在浏览器主窗口的地址栏中输入想要访问的_2_的_1_或_2_地址并确认后,浏览器就开始在因特网上查找该_2_的主页,一旦找到就可进行浏览。 它的工作基础是解释执行用_3_语言书写的文件。 A:⑴文本文件 ⑵图像文件 ⑶多媒体文件 ⑷网页文件B:⑴端点 ⑵站点 ⑶起点 ⑷终点C:⑴域名 ⑵用户名 ⑶文件名 ⑷目录名D:⑴LAN ⑵WAN ⑶IP ⑷TCPE:⑴VC ⑵C++ ⑶HTML ⑷HTTP
socket跟TCP/IP 的关系,单台服务器上的并发TCP连接数可以有多少
并发连接数最好在1024以内
协议分为哪几部分,在计算机网络中有100%可靠稳定的协议吗?
(1)语法:即数据与控制信息的结构或格式; (2)语义:即需要发出何种控制信息,完成何种动作以及做出何种响应; (3)时序,即事件实现顺序的详细说明。 计算机通信网是由许多具有信息交换和处理能力的节点互连而成的. 要使整个网络有条不紊地工作, 就要求每个节点必须遵守一些事先约定好的有关数据格式及时序等的规则。 这些为实现网络数据交换而建立的规则、约定或标准就称为网络协议。 协议是通信双方为了实现通信而设计的约定或通话规则。 协议总是指某一层的协议。 准确地说,它是在同等层之间的实体通信时,有关通信规则和约定的集合就是该层协议,例如物理层协议、传输层协议、应用层协议。
评论一下吧
取消回复